Creating order lines with dynamic price and VAT calulation

We need a way to create order and/or orderline that will take
NetAmount, discount, unitCost, margin and so on from the product,
associated with this line. For now when we're trying to create a line
using OrderLine_CreateFromData we got an error " The element 'data' in
namespace 'http://e-conomic.com' has incomplete content. List of
possible elements expected: 'MarginAsPercent' in namespace
'http://e-conomic.com'" if we're trying not to send this data
created Jun 20, 2013 by vsdev
